Glassnode is not a custodial platform, but it is a nerve center. Its data feeds power hedge funds, exchanges, and media. The exposure of client emails isn't a code exploit; it’s a social engineering roadmap.
Let’s dissect the forensic facts. Glassnode disclosed that an unauthorized party may have accessed customer email addresses. The company immediately warned users of targeted phishing attempts. No private keys, no chain data, no trading history—yet. But the vector is clear: attackers now possess a verified list of individuals deeply involved in cryptocurrency, from analysts to executives. This is the perfect fuel for a spear-phishing campaign.
What makes this event different from a typical corporate data breach is the context. Glassnode sits at the intersection of institutional and retail crypto analytics. Its client base includes some of the largest liquidity providers and trading desks. A single successful phishing attack could compromise API keys, exchange login credentials, or even access to sensitive portfolio dashboards. The risk is not systemic to the blockchain, but it is existential for the individuals and firms targeted.
I’ve seen this pattern before during the DeFi summer of 2020. When a data aggregator leaks user emails, the real damage takes weeks to surface. Attackers don’t rush. They craft believable emails referencing Glassnode’s analytics, urging recipients to ‘verify account details’ or ‘update security settings.’ The cognitive load on a busy trader is high. One click, one compromised password, and the dominoes fall.
But here’s the contrarian angle: this breach is not a failure of blockchain technology—it’s a failure of web2 security practices. Glassnode, like many crypto-native companies, relies on centralized databases for user management. The industry preaches decentralization, yet the soft underbelly remains the same old email/password infrastructure. Chainlink didn’t fail; DeFi protocols didn’t fail. A central server with inadequate access controls did. And that’s the uncomfortable truth we often ignore.
